Assist King: Black Stars midfielder Daniel-Kofi Kyereh provides 6th assists for St Pauli in Bundesliga 2

Ghanaian offensive midfielder Daniel-Kofi Kyereh provided his 6th league assist of the season in the Bundesliga II on Sunday when St Pauli thrashed Dynamo Dresden 3-0.

The 25-year-old set up the opening goal for Christopher Buchtmann at the Millerntor-Stadion on the 2nd minute as the former Bundesliga campaigners their 6th victory of the season which has pushed them to 1st on the league log.

Kyereh, born in Accra to a German mother and a Ghanaian father, has been capped once by Ghana as he earned his Black Stars debut during last month’s FIFA World Cup qualifier against Ethiopia.

He has now set up 6 goals for his teammates in the league and has scored twice himself.
